Preheat oven to 350 F.
2
For the crust:
3
In a mixing bowl using your stand mixer, whip butter until light and fluffy. Then add flour, brown sugar and cinnamon. Beat for 2 minutes at medium speed or until crumbly. Press mixture into an un-greased 9x13 pan. Bake for 12 minutes at 350 F. Remove from oven and set aside.
4
For the filling: In a clean mixing bowl, beat cream cheese until smooth. Then add in sugar, flour and eggs. Use a wooden spoon to stir in 1 cup of chocolate chips. Pour the mixture over the crust and smooth it out. Return to the oven for 20 minutes, or until almost set.
5
Remove pan from oven long enough to sprinkle remaining chocolate chips on top. Return to oven for 1 more minute to soften chocolate chips. Pull pan from oven, and carefully spread melted chips over the whole top. Sprinkle with nuts and press lightly. Refrigerate 1 hour before cutting into bars.
